精简HTML代码
精简HTML代码是网站代码优化的重要部分。首先,去除不必要的标签和属性。例如,一些冗余的div嵌套可能会增加代码的复杂性,但实际上对页面布局和功能没有实质帮助,将其去除可以让代码更简洁。其次,合理使用HTML5的新特性。像新的语义化标签如
优化CSS代码
对于CSS代码优化,一是要避免内联样式。内联样式会使HTML代码变得臃肿,而且不利于代码的维护和复用。将样式统一写在独立的CSS文件中,这样可以方便地对整个网站的样式进行管理。二是精简CSS选择器。复杂的选择器会增加浏览器解析的时间,尽量使用简单直接的选择器。例如,优先使用类选择器而不是后代选择器等复杂的选择器。三是合并和压缩CSS文件。将多个CSS文件合并成一个,然后进行压缩,去除其中的空白和注释,这样可以减少文件大小,加快页面加载时对样式文件的获取速度。
JavaScript代码的优化
在JavaScript代码优化方面,首先要减少全局变量的使用。全局变量会占用更多的内存空间,并且可能会导致变量名冲突等问题。将变量的作用域尽可能地限制在函数内部。其次,避免在HTML中直接嵌入大量JavaScript代码。可以将JavaScript代码写在独立的.js文件中,然后在HTML中引用。这样有助于提高代码的可维护性。再者,优化循环。例如,在循环中避免重复计算相同的值,可以将计算结果缓存起来。还有,对JavaScript代码进行压缩和混淆。压缩可以减少文件大小,混淆则可以保护代码的安全性,防止代码被轻易解读,这在提升网站性能的同时也保障了代码的安全性。

优化图片相关代码
优化图片相关代码也是网站代码优化的关键。一方面,要正确设置图片的尺寸。在HTML中明确指定图片的宽度和高度,这样可以避免页面在加载图片时出现布局的跳动。另一方面,采用合适的图片格式。例如,对于颜色简单、线条清晰的图像,使用PNG - 8格式;对于照片等色彩丰富的图像,使用JPEG格式。并且,使用图片懒加载技术。懒加载意味着图片只有在进入浏览器的可视区域时才会加载,这对于包含大量图片的页面非常有用,可以大大提高页面的初始加载速度。
优化网站的导航代码
网站导航代码的优化不容忽视。导航结构应该清晰明了,使用语义化的HTML标签构建导航菜单。例如,使用
提高代码的兼容性
提高代码的兼容性是网站代码优化的一个重要方面。在编写代码时,要考虑到不同浏览器的兼容性。例如,某些CSS属性在不同浏览器中的显示效果可能不同,需要进行相应的调整。可以使用一些前端框架或者工具来辅助处理兼容性问题,如Bootstrap等,它们提供了跨浏览器兼容的样式和脚本。同时,也要考虑到不同设备的兼容性,尤其是在移动端。确保网站在各种屏幕尺寸和分辨率的设备上都能正常显示和交互,这需要采用响应式设计的理念,通过媒体查询等技术来调整页面的布局和样式。